  • Patent number: 11132684
    Abstract: Systems and methods for verifying individuals prior to distribution of one or more benefits are disclosed. One exemplary method includes receiving, at a server, a proof-of-life validation from a payment service provider. The proof-of-life validation is based on receipt of a valid biometric from the individual at a payment device associated with the individual, and a transaction using said payment device. The method further includes distributing the benefit to a benefit account associated with the individual, when the proof-of-life validation is received within a time interval of the benefit distribution date.

  • Patent number: 11042852
    Abstract: Techniques are described for sender authenticated remittance via an automatic teller machine (ATM). The techniques include transferring money between a sender and a recipient via the ATM without the recipient needing a computing device or a bank account with which to receive the money. The disclosed techniques enable a remittance server to interact with both the sender via a sender computing device and the recipient via the ATM to perform a money transfer in which the recipient is at least partially authenticated by the sender. The ATM is configured to take a picture or a video of the recipient to be sent by the remittance server to the sender computing device for approval by the sender prior to allocating the transferred money to the recipient. In this way, the remittance server essentially passes control of the ATM and the remittance of the transferred money to the sender.

  • Patent number: 10937103
    Abstract: Aspects of the disclosure relate to using machine learning algorithms to analyze vehicle operational data associated with a vehicle accident. In some instances, an accident assessment server may receive data indicating that a vehicle was involved in an accident. The accident assessment server may compare the data with other known data, based on machine learning algorithms, to identify whether the accident resulted in a total loss. Responsive to determining that the accident resulted in the total loss, the accident assessment server may request further information regarding the vehicle and may identify a baseline value range for the vehicle. The accident assessment server may request updated information from the owner of the vehicle, identify, based on the updated information, a final value of the vehicle, and may pay the owner of the vehicle an amount corresponding to the final value if the final value is within the baseline value range.

  • Patent number: 10853882
    Abstract: A method and system may analyze the liability of drivers involved in a vehicle crash based on video image data of the vehicle crash. When a vehicle crash occurs, several image capturing devices may transmit sets of video images captured within a predetermined threshold distance and time of the scene of the vehicle crash. The sets of video images may be combined, aggregated, and/or assembled chronologically and spatially to form a compilation which may depict the sequence of events leading up to, during, and immediately after the vehicle crash. Based on the compilation, percentages of fault may be allocated to each of the drivers involved in the vehicle crash and the amount of liability may be assessed for each of the drivers.
